Cork Flooring – Because Cork Isn’t Just For Wine Anymore!

January 4, 2013 by admin

Cork seems to be a term we consider to be synonymous with the wine industry, but did you know that cork has many more uses and can actually make all the difference when choosing a flooring option for your home?  Cork is a natural flooring option that has the potential to add a beautifully unique aspect to your home. Not only is it environmentally friendly, it also has immense benefits for your health and your pocket book.

What is cork?

Cork oak is the outside bark of cork trees that are found throughout Europe in countries like Spain, Portugal, France and Morocco. A cork tree’s average lifespan is anywhere from 250-300 years, and its bark can only be harvested after a 25 year period of growth.  Each layer of cork that is harvested can yield hundreds upon hundreds of kilograms of cork that can be used to create flooring options that will leave you feeling as though you are walking on air. The harvesting of cork bark is also done in a sustainable and safe manner that does no damage to these rare trees.

How is cork flooring made?

After the initial 25+ year growth period, the bark of a cork tree can be harvested once every nine years. After each harvest, the bark is left for months to dry before being transported to a factory. In the factory, wine corks are cut out of the bark and the excess is boiled down and compressed into flooring pieces using various resins and adhesives. Cork flooring pieces can be made in nearly 40 different colors and in infinite shapes and sizes.

Cost of cork flooring?

As with any flooring option, the price and quality of a product depends solely on the procedures and materials used by the manufacturer. The average cost of cork flooring can range anywhere from $4- $8 per square foot depending on quality, style and the company that produces it.

What are the advantages of cork floors?

The advantages of installing cork floors are immense including that it’s:

  • Durable & affordable
  • Insect resistant
  • Sound resistant
  • Fire resistant
  • Shock absorbent
  • Compression bounce back
  • Environmentally friendly
    • Less toxic than vinyl in production stages
    • Completely renewable
